Africa :: Egypt
The Pyramids of Khufu (left) and Khafre on the Giza Plateau outside of Cairo. The former, also known as the Great Pyramid, is the largest of the pyramids and is the only one of the Seven Wonders of the Ancient World still extant.
Factbook photos - obtained from a wide variety of sources - are in the public domain and are copyright free.
Agency Copyright Notice
Dimension | File Size
480 X 640 pixels 45.03 KB
Download - only file size available